Kelly gets to intern at the local television news station and they cast her as the weather girl. Soon, she gets a huge contract after an anchor forces them to choose between the dumb blonde or him. She jokes "they canned him like a can of tuna." Marcy is still single and looking for Mr. Right, maybe the news guy. Anyway, Kelly is earning a lot of money compared to Al's pathetic salary. She is just about to sign a contract and she has already bought a new car, a Porsche. Unfortunately and usually for the Bundys, nothing every goes according to plan because if it did. The Bundys would be living high and enjoying life and that's not the purpose of the show.

Remember that sleazy pink dress that Christina Applegate wore for the Gutter Cats rock video? How could you forget? Well, she wears it again for this episode in which Kelly gets a $1000 a week internship at the Channel 83 TV station, working as a weather bunny. Al's big news is that he has got himself a $5 a week raise at the shoe store.

Naturally, Kelly's sexiness improves the channel's viewership (much like it did for Fox) and pretty soon she has been offered a $250K a year contract (a mere pittance compared to what Christina Applegate was earning). Al quits his job at the shoe store to become Kelly's manager, but while Al considers the station's offer, Kelly screws up on the job, the girl unable to read the autocue, and she is given the push; with the contract torn up, Al is forced to go back to selling shoes for a living.

Applegate is the star of this episode, and she is as excellent as always, but despite another sterling performance playing stupid ("Winds are up to 30 moofs"), it is Bud who gets the best line this time around: "Why don't they just put some peanut butter on her gums like they did with Mister Ed?"
